Israel Bound

Our flagship three-week summer teen trip open to St. Louis-area students and Camp Sabra participants continues to be one of the most popular trips for St. Louis teens and young adults who want to travel to Israel. It aims to help teens explore their Jewish identity, deepen their connection to Israel, and build lifelong friendships. From floating in the Dead Sea, to climbing Masada at sunrise, the itinerary is packed with iconic experiences, plus unique highlights like home hospitality in our partnership region, geo-political briefings, and a night under the stars in the Negev Desert.

Benefits of a local trip:
  • Teens can experience Israel with their friends from school/synagogue
  • Pre-trip meetings allow for proper orientation and group bonding before we depart
  • Post-trip reunions allow for proper processing of the experience and continued social connection with trip participants
  • Local staff you can trust and meet in person prior to the trip

High School Academic Programs

Continue your academic studies as you experience your “classroom without walls,” the land of Israel. Over 3,000 years of history will come alive as you travel throughout the country with this hands-on approach to learning. Half and full semester options are available.

Gap Year Programs
Consider spending five months to a year in Israel while earning college credit. Nothing else can put a lifetime of Jewish education into context as well as a long-term Israel program in which you can unpack your bags, study, volunteer and experience the country in an authentic, genuine way.

Subsidies are available through MASA, a joint project of the Jewish Agency for Israel.

Teen Merit Based Scholarship to Israel

The Stuart I. Pessin merit-based grant awards four St. Louis teens $1500 toward their Israel experience.

Passport to Israel

We help make travel accessible for families and young adults through need-based and incentive-based scholarships and grants, as well as long-term investment opportunities to ease the cost of a quality Israel experience. We offer long-term savings programs and rolling travel grants. Our support ensures cost isn’t a barrier to these life-shaping experiences. Teens and young adults are eligible to apply for grants toward trips lasting two or more weeks.
